Lynne Cameron is a scholar working on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, Language and Linguistics and Literature and Literary Theory. According to data from OpenAlex, Lynne Cameron has authored 56 papers receiving a total of 4.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, 26 papers in Language and Linguistics and 16 papers in Literature and Literary Theory. Recurrent topics in Lynne Cameron's work include Language, Metaphor, and Cognition (35 papers), Language, Discourse, Communication Strategies (16 papers) and Discourse Analysis in Language Studies (12 papers). Lynne Cameron is often cited by papers focused on Language, Metaphor, and Cognition (35 papers), Language, Discourse, Communication Strategies (16 papers) and Discourse Analysis in Language Studies (12 papers). Lynne Cameron coll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Brazil. Lynne Cameron's co-authors include Diane Larsen‐Freeman, Alice Deignan, Robert Maslen, Raymond W. Gibbs, Graham Low, Zazie Todd, Juup Stelma, Neil Stanley, Peter Stratton and John Maule and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Modern Language Journal and Applied Linguistics.
